CC13xx/CC26xx Border Router over UART
|
||||||
|
=====================================
|
||||||
|
The platform code can be used as a border router (SLIP over UART) by using the
|
||||||
|
example under `examples/ipv6/rpl-border-router`. This example defines the
|
||||||
|
following:
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
#ifndef UIP_CONF_BUFFER_SIZE
|
||||||
|
#define UIP_CONF_BUFFER_SIZE 140
|
||||||
|
#endif
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
#ifndef UIP_CONF_RECEIVE_WINDOW
|
||||||
|
#define UIP_CONF_RECEIVE_WINDOW 60
|
||||||
|
#endif
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
The CC26xx port has much higher capability than some other platforms used as
|
||||||
|
border routers. Thus, before building the example, it is recommended to delete
|
||||||
|
these two configuration directives. This will allow platform defaults to take
|
||||||
|
effect and this will improve performance and stability.
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
Do not forget to set the correct channel by defining `RF_CORE_CONF_CHANNEL` as
|
||||||
|
required.

CC13xx/CC26xx slip-radio with 6lbr
|
||||||
|
==================================
|
||||||
|
The platform can also operate as a slip-radio over UART, to be used with
|
||||||
|
[6lbr](http://cetic.github.io/6lbr/).
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
Similar to the border router configuration, you will need to remove the defines
|
||||||
|
that limit the size of the uIP buffer. Removing the two lines below from
|
||||||
|
`examples/ipv6/slip-radio/project-conf.h` should do it.
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
#undef UIP_CONF_BUFFER_SIZE
|
||||||
|
#define UIP_CONF_BUFFER_SIZE 140
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
Do not forget to set the correct channel by defining `RF_CORE_CONF_CHANNEL` as
|
||||||
|
required.
